As promised last night here's the video I took during the early evening visit by our regular fox. This is one of the first videos I've made with the Canon 7D. It's hand-held (I was also shooting stills) and it took me a while to get used to focusing as the fox moved about. It's shot in high definition and given the relatively poor light and high ISO settings (around ISO 1000) the overall quality is pretty good (the quality of the camera handling is another matter entirely!).
